Case Study — How an Electrical Distributor Moved Contractor Orders Online with a Self-Service System
Overview
Client: Electrical supply distributor
Catalog Size: 25,000+ SKUs
Customers: Contractors & commercial buyers
Core Challenge: Manual ordering + slow product discovery
The Problem
Before the system:
- Contractors were placing orders via phone and email
- Sales reps handled repeat orders manually
- Orders were re-entered into ERP systems
- Customers couldn’t easily find products by SKU or specs
- Pricing varied per account and wasn’t visible online
Key issue
Repeat orders required manual work—every single time.
The Goal
Create a system where:
- Contractors can reorder quickly without contacting sales
- Products can be found instantly by SKU or specifications
- Customers see their own pricing automatically
- Orders flow directly into backend systems
What We Built
1. Catalog Structuring & Data Modeling
- Organized 25,000+ SKUs into structured categories
- Standardized product attributes (voltage, type, compatibility, etc.)
- Built a foundation for fast filtering and search
2. Search & Filtering System
- Enabled SKU-based quick search
- Added spec-based filtering for technical products
- Reduced time to find products significantly
3. B2B Reordering System
- Quick order by SKU entry
- Reordering from past purchases
- Saved product lists for contractors
4. Customer-Specific Pricing
- Displayed account-based pricing automatically
- Supported volume discounts and contract pricing
5. ERP Integration
- Orders synced directly into backend systems
- Reduced manual data entry and errors
The Outcome
Operational Improvements
- Reduced manual order processing significantly
- Faster order handling and fewer errors
Customer Experience
- Contractors can reorder in seconds
- Easier product discovery across large catalogs
Business Impact
- Increased repeat order frequency
- Reduced dependency on sales reps
- Improved scalability of operations
